Day 1: Riverboat Trip and Monkey Island
Your 3-day jungle adventure begins with a morning departure from Iquitos to the Nanay port in Bellavista.
You’ll take a 2-hour riverboat trip on the Rio Nanay, spotting wildlife like caimans, turtles, and dolphins.
Next, you’ll visit Monkey Island to observe and interact with various monkey species, including sloths, capuchins, and spider monkeys.
After, you’ll have the chance to watch and potentially swim with pink dolphins.
As the day winds down, you’ll embark on a nocturnal nature hike before settling in for the night at the Maniti Eco-Lodge.
Day 2: Sunrise, Fishing, and Caiman Spotting
Waking up to the stunning sunrise over the Amazon River, the group embarks on an animal observation excursion by boat.
They spot a variety of wildlife, including unique bird species and playful pink dolphins.
In the afternoon, the group tries their hand at fishing, reeling in piranhas and catfish.
Later, they witness the remarkable Victoria Regia, a giant water lily native to the region.
As the sun sets, the group sets out in canoes to spot caiman, the Amazon’s iconic crocodilian creatures, under the cover of darkness.
A full day of exploration and discovery awaits.

Transportation and Accommodations
The tour includes pickup locations at the DoubleTree by Hilton Hotel Iquitos, Coronel FAP Francisco Secada Vignetta International Airport, and Casa Morey Hotel & Restaurant.
All local transportation, such as tuk-tuks and riverboats, is provided throughout the tour. Accommodations are at the Maniti Eco-Lodge, where guests will stay in private lodgings with bedding and shower facilities.
The tour includes amenities like Wi-Fi at the lodge. The transportation and accommodations are designed to provide a comfortable and seamless jungle adventure experience.
